Resumen:
Aniline and methyl, ethyl, propyl and methoxy ring substituted derivatives have been polymerized by electrochemical methods. The reduction of the film produces ageing of the polymers. This is followed by the changes in the current/ potential profile of the voltammetric response. The effect of the substituents produces changes in both the extent and the rate of ageing. The rate of ageing can be represented by a Roginsky- Zeldovich or Elovich type of kinetics characterized by a pseudo zero order rate constant and a self inhibiting parameter. Both parameters and the extent of ageing are related to the free volume available for the different types of polymers.
